The Northwest Boise City housing market is somewhat competitive. The median sale price of a home in Northwest Boise City was $460K last month, up 15.9%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Northwest Boise City is $319, up 6.0% since last year.
What is the housing market like in Northwest Boise City today?
In March 2024, Northwest Boise City home prices were up 15.9%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$460K. On average, homes in Northwest Boise City sell after 12 days on the market compared to 62 days last year. There were 21 homes sold in March this year, up from 14 last year.

How hot is the Northwest Boise City housing market?
Northwest Boise City is somewhat competitive. Homes sell in 20.5 days.

Flood Factor
Northwest Boise City has a minor risk of flooding. 124 properties in Northwest Boise City are likely to be
severely affected
by flooding over the next 30 years. This represents 68% of all properties in Northwest Boise City. Flood risk is increasing slower than the national average.
84% of properties are at risk of wildfire over the next 30 years
Fire Factor
Northwest Boise City has a moderate risk of wildfire. There are 1,842 properties in Northwest Boise City that have some risk of being affected by wildfire over the next 30 years. This represents 84% of all properties in Northwest Boise City.
Northwest Boise City has minimal risk of severe winds over the next 30 years
Wind Factor
Northwest Boise City has a Minimal Wind Factor®, which means there is a very low likelihood that hurricane, tornado or severe storm winds will impact this area.
